World Of Wearable Art 2018

The WOW awards show is a world renowned creative competition which showcases the work of some of the most creative minds from across the globe. For over 30 years this amazing competition has been challenging to create a piece of wearable art that is original, innovative and truly exceptional.

In 2018 I was priviledged to be one of the 140 finalists chosen from hundreds of international entrants. I then went on to win the 2nd Prize in the Reflective Surfaces category with my Hilandera entry.

Las Hilanderas (“The Spinners”) by Velazquez, also known as the Fable of Arachne, was the source of inspiration for the garment Hilandera.
Velazquez’s painting depicting the fable shows the mortal Arachne challenged by the goddess Athena to a weaving competition. On winning, Athena turned Arachne into a spider.


Like a spider I weaved onto a circular frame, treating threads with resins and weaving in graduated colours to create the garment. The beauty of the resulting garment is the lightness, the sinuosity of the curvaceous shapes lightly wrapping the body in an infinite loop.
